Ivan Nova strikes out 11 in Pirates' win Tuesday
Pittsburgh Pirates pitcher Ivan Nova allowed two runs (and only one earned run) over six innings on Tuesday, striking out 11 as the Pirates beat the Philadelphia Phillies 5-3.
Those 11 strikeouts crushed his previous season-high of eight, giving him his most since 2013.
Nova has bounced back from a couple of rough seasons, and his 4.03 ERA and 3.77 SIERA are both his best marks since 2013. His 19.0 percent strikeout rate and 4.5 percent walk rate through 149 2/3 innings are both better than his career averages.
